Have now been using the quick fender clips by Phender Pro which is what Cobalt installs as an option. They Rock, it is a quick grab from storage the 3 fenders that are already set up at length for the boat and pop them in, takes less that 20 seconds to set all three of them when coming in to dock, no fumbling tying off. They are expensive yes but everyone on the boat always comments on how great they are, people on the dock also admire them, When leaving the dock reach over push pin and pull and throw back in storage. Easy peasy. Just thought others might want to know if they are worth the investment. Absolutely

So I’ve tied up to new cobalts that have these and my only beef with them is if you are tying up to another boat the fenders sit too low. So the rub rails will touch. So we ended up wedging a fender between tied very close to my center cleat. So they wouldn’t bump each other

I have the quick factory installed clips on my R5 Surf and my Marker One but sometimes have the need to raise or lower them depending upon the dock or the size boat I’m tied up to in the middle of the lake. I found these and installed them on my quick clips and they are amazingly easy to adjust. Best fenders I’ve ever owned. The company is Mission and it is called their Sentry Fender.
